- Welcome Service for Master and PhD. Students
For Master Students and Ph.D. Candidates without proficient German language skills, we offer the Welcome Service to make your arrival and first steps at the University of Bonn a bit easier. Within the first few days/weeks of your arrival, we would be happy to assist you - on request - with the following administrative procedures:
► Signing a lease*
(Please Note: payment of the first month's rent and security deposit are due at signing. *Service is only offered to students who have received a room in a student residence hall offered by the 'Studierendenwerk')
► Registration at the Registration Office in Bonn
► Opening a Bank Account
► Obtaining Health Insurance
► Enrolling at the University of Bonn
► Contacting the Foreigners' Office for your Residence Permit.
► The Welcome Service includes - in case of a handicap (e. g. physical disability) - your pick up from the train- or bus station in Bonn and the accompaniment to your student dorm (from the Studierendenwerk) or other accommodation facilities (other than a hotel).
The Welcome Service is carried out by students at the University of Bonn. These students will either arrange a private date with you, or will invite you to join a small group of new International Students (due to the large influx of International Students at the beginning of the Winter Semester), to complete the bureaucratic procedures.
